My experience at Paramount Ford Hyundai was simply amazing! Easiest and most enjoyable car-buying experience I have ever had. My original contact was with William Boston who very promptly replied to my emails in an friendly and professional manner. When I arrived at the dealership William was busy and could not help me but he did greet me and happily referred me to one of his co-workers, Brent Buff, who, like William was very friendly and professional. Brent was with me till I drove off in my New Ram 1500! (Well, new to me at least :p). It was a used 2011 Ram 1500 In near perfect condition. Brent wasted no time getting me the car fax while I searched over the truck for anything that I might have wrong. He gave me plenty of space and time and did not try to rush me at all. Brent spoke with my mother and I while we looked the truck over but never hovered behind us while we checked the truck put. We were given plenty of space. I really want to emphasize that, other dealers that we went to before we came to Paramount rushed us and followed us around making excuses for the vehicle. We found my Ram to be in near perfect condition for it's year and milage and Brent explained to me everything the service department had done to the truck when it arrived at their car lot. Brent was very informative and kind throughout the entire experience. As well as all the salesmen I encountered! We were even given some bottles of water while we waited on the financial paperwork. (It was pretty hot that day) MY ONLY COMPLAINT about my entire experience; When it came time for me to sign the papers it was brought up that I could purchase a warrenty for the used vehicle. After thinking about it and weighing my options i decided I did not want the warranty. The financial agent I worked with (I think is name was Marc) insisted the warranty should stay on the purchase agreement so that he could get the credit for the sale, that all I would have to do is tell the bank I didn't want the warranty and they would simply subtract the difference (naturally the bank would not do that and needed a new purchase agreement without the warranty on it). I may be getting it mixed up about how all that commission and stuff works. My problem was not the fact that he wanted credit. I understand that everyone's got a job to do and thats how those folks make a living. Thats all fine. The fact that he said he wanted something to stay on the agreement just so he could get the credit came across to me that he was putting himself before the customer. In my book, that is a poor example of customer service. The customer should always come first. HOWEVER I did not allow that to diminish my over all experience with Paramount Ford Hyundai! It was an excellent experience that I have already shared with several people. I would (and will) most definitely recommend this dealership to my friends, family and co-workers in the future! OVERALL EXPERIENCE WAS EXCELLENT! Thank you for a wonderful car buying experience!

I had one of the best, if most unusual buying experiences ever at Paramount Ford Hyundai in Valdese. It stated on 1/2/23 when my wife and I went for service on her 2016 Hyundai Tuscon. While there, we decided to discuss with some salespeople if trading in her car or selling it to our son when he turned 16 would provide us with the larger amount toward a new vehicle when it was time. We spoke to Justin, who though obviously new to the dealership staff was very helpful. He provided us with some great information and we decided it might be worth it to look into trading her car in. Justin brought in CJ who helped us to find the car of my wife's dreams. A 2023 Hyundai Tuscon with an amazing package. She loved this car, but we had a price point to meet. The staff at Paramount worked with us to get a really great deal together that got us the car she loved at our price point. It took some haggling, but I felt the dealership did a great job by us and my wife was so happy with her new Tucson And then less than 24 hours latter she wrecked the car in the rain. Luckily no serious injuries. I called out insurance people who didn't have a preferred shop, so I called the dealership and they sprung into action to help again. They recommended K&M and we had the car towed there. Then throughout the week while we waited for GEICO to decide on fixing the car, Paramount called us several time, checking in to make sure everyone was still physically okay and seeking to help us through the process of the car's appraisal and possible replacement. CJ, especially, called to discuss options for us if we needed. When GEICO did total the first car out, my next call was to CJ at Paramount to discuss the options. We would have less of a down payment now since we didn't have the old car, but Paramount promised to work to get us into the car we wanted. And they delivered! They looked all over the region over the MLK holiday weekend and found another 2023 Hyundai Tucson with all features my wife wanted. The second Tucson didn't ahve a sun-roof and leather seats, but she didn't care about that. It had the automatic start, heated seats, and power lift gate that was the deal breaker for her. CJ and the Paramount Team really listened to what she wanted and found another car of a slightly lower trim level that would offset the cost difference from the now smaller down payment. They rolled our extended warranty and GAP coverage we had bought for the other 2023 Tucson to this new Tucson since it was less than 30 days. And the finance folks even found a better finance deal, and the new car's monthly payment is $20 less than the previous one. Paramount worked so hard to help us, and really went above and beyond to help us make it work, twice!

I drove over 2.5 hours (one way) to Paramount Ford to test drive a Ford F-250 which I had found through an internet vehicle search. After having recently dealt with other car dealers in the greater Raleigh area looking for the same type of truck and being dealt with the typical shenanigans of bait-and-switch, strong arm sales tactics and poor communication, I called Paramount to see if their truck was still available prior to making the drive. Salesman Andrew helped me on the phone and promised to call me if there was any change to the truck's status while I was driving. When I arrived, Andrew was very pleasant and personable and had the truck ready for a test drive. Both before and after the test drive, I was able to look carefully around the truck and under the hood. Andrew was very patient and explained the truck's features and was willing to answer any questions. He didn't perform the common distracting salesman jibber-jabber and pushiness. Rather, he was very respectful and let me look at the vehicle. After agreeing to talk about pricing/trade-in, I was preparing myself for the 'ole sales routine like I mentioned above. To my shear amazement and surprise, Paramount is no ordinary delearship. The negotiation was painless and very fair (based on my weeks of research prior to the purchase) nor did we spend hours upon end haggling over little things. The finance manager Ryan was also very pleasant and in no means did he do the common "finance-manager-strong-arm-sales-push" on any extras or things I did not want. He respectfully offered them to me but did not push me or give me the woe-is-you-if-you-don't-buy-this-extra-stuff song and dance routine. Both Andrew and Ryan were down-to-earth young men who presented Paramount in an exceedingly positive light. I was at the dealership for a total of 4 hours prior to driving back to Apex in my new "preowned" F-250. A good portion of that time was due to my having to verify financial transactions with the bank and update my insurance. I had planned to purchase a similar truck at Carmax the following day; however, I'm so glad I took a chance with Paramount. I will definitely drive 5 hours round-trip to purchase another car from them when the time comes. My sincere appreciation to Andrew, Ryan and the other employees who took part in making my purchase a very pleasant experience. And to the owner of Paramount Ford, it's my hope you recognize these employees for their exemplary customer service.
